Default what are the pros and cons for longtravel a arms

Can someone tell me what the advantage of long travel a arms and the disadvantage i do alot of trail riding and love to jump oh this is on a lt250r..

advantages: smoother ride, better traction (more sag with more travel, so ur tires stay on the ground more, even when the trail suddenly drops off), and more upward travel for smoother landings.

cons: some long travel kits raise the ride height and create a lot of body roll, and they cost a lot.

my opinion: i wish i could afford a long travel front end. i would get a lobo II front end, or a gibson front end. the A-arms are designed to give a lot of travel, while keeping a low ride height for awesome cornering. then i'd get ELKA quad rate shocks with slow/fast damping adjusters, as well as threaded pre-load and rebound adjusters. they will absorb all hits, and create an awesome ride. also, the shock companies build the shocks to your sepcifications, and the type of riding u do, so they will work awesome for trails if u have them built that way.

will my a arms be to low to the ground when my sus is compresed to ride rough trails

they shouldn't be. that's part of what the shock company does, they adjust the pre-load on the shocks so that that shouldn't be a problem. however, if ur gonna spend the money on all these high dollar components, i would also get a full body skid plate, and a-arm skid plates, especially if you ride through any rocky areas. i would reccomend the AC Racing full chasis skid plate, it wraps up in front of the front bumper adding a lil x-tra protection.
